Here is today’s update from Kendra's mom Joni...

We’re incredibly grateful for the steady improvements Kendra continues to make, and even today we saw some encouraging steps forward. That said, today also brought a few challenges.

We learned that Kendra experienced a seizure during yesterday’s MRI. The medical team was able to capture the entire event on video, which allowed them to confirm with 100% certainty that it was not an epileptic seizure.

We also received more clarity on the infections she’s fighting. While all are significant, the most serious is a bacterial infection related to the ventilator tube, involving her trachea and the pneumonia that has subsequently developed. The doctors advised us that it is a serious and significant infection with potentially life-altering risks if not controlled quickly, so this remains a top priority.

Lastly, the doctors are reassessing several of her medications. There is concern that some of them may be counteracting one another or complicating her current conditions. The team is working carefully to establish the safest and most effective treatment protocol moving forward.

We continue to give God thanks every day and have the utmost confidence that He opened the door for Kendra to receive treatment at this medical center and that He is involved in every decision being made.
